Comprehending Digital Gaming Entry Barriers



Affordable entry represents a pillar of modern online gambling establishments. The base required initial payment typically varies from $1 to $20, though this changes markedly based on jurisdiction, payment method, and platform positioning. Based on industry data from 2023, approximately 68% of new players start with deposits under $25, revealing the market demand for affordable entry points.



Processing fees directly determine these thresholds. Digital currency transfers often enable lower requirements compared to classic banking approaches, where processing fees make tiny transactions economically impossible for operators. The relationship between payment infrastructure and accessibility continues shaping how venues structure their financial requirements.

Key Strategies for Low-Threshold Gaming



Opting for a venue based only on minimal deposit requirements represents an partial strategy. Several critical factors deserve comparable consideration:




  • Payout limits: Low thresholds become irrelevant if withdrawal minimums exceed what casual players typically gather

  • Payment method restrictions: The smallest deposit options often leave out certain banking methods, particularly conventional payment systems

  • Incentive requirements: Many promotional offers activate only above specific deposit amounts, essentially creating two-tiered accessibility

  • Game contribution rates: Slots typically contribute 100% toward playthrough requirements, while traditional games often contribute only 10-20%

  • Time-limited promotions: Periodic offers may reduce minimum thresholds during special campaigns

  • Identity verification schedule: Some platforms require identity verification before processing any deposits, independent of amount

Micro-Transaction Technical Infrastructure



Back-end payment architecture establishes practical minimum thresholds. Classic merchant processors charge base fees with percentage cuts, making transactions under $10 relatively pricey for operators. Digital wallets and cryptocurrency networks offer alternatives with lower transaction costs, enabling genuinely accessible entry points.



Platform selection increasingly hinges on payment versatility. Venues accepting cryptocurrency, prepaid vouchers, or digital payment systems reliably offer lower minimums than those relying exclusively on classic payment processors. The technical infrastructure supporting transactions directly shapes accessibility for cost-aware participants.



Regulatory Influence on Platforms



Geographic requirements significantly influence deposit structures. Some regulatory agencies mandate maximum deposit limits for new accounts during initial periods, while others require operators to enforce affordability checks at specific thresholds. These oversight demands create disparate accessibility landscapes across various regions, making regional considerations relevant to platform selection.
